Can I Use Funds from an Old HSA Account for Anything?

As you navigate through your finances, you may wonder if you can use funds from an old HSA account for anything. Health Savings Accounts (HSAs) provide tax advantages for medical expenses, but what about funds that have been sitting in your account?

Here's what you need to know:

  • Funds in your HSA do not expire, so you can continue to use them even if you change jobs or health plans.
  • You can use the funds in your old HSA account for eligible medical expenses, regardless of when the expenses were incurred.
  • Qualified medical expenses include doctor's visits, prescription medications, and certain medical procedures.
  • If you are 65 or older, you can also use HSA funds for non-medical expenses without penalty, though you will pay income tax on the amount withdrawn.
  • It's essential to keep track of your expenses and receipts to ensure you are using your HSA funds appropriately.

Remember, using funds from an old HSA account for non-qualified expenses before age 65 may result in penalties and taxes. However, for eligible medical expenses, your HSA funds remain available to you indefinitely.
